Getting your money out of an online casino shouldn't be a struggle. In South Africa, withdrawal times vary a lot between operators. Some process verified accounts within hours; others batch EFT payments once or twice per day. The difference comes down to payment infrastructure, FICA compliance processes, and which withdrawal methods the operator supports.

This page covers the 10 fastest-paying casinos available to South African players in 2026, breaks down how each withdrawal method compares on speed, and explains what steps you can take to receive your money sooner. Withdrawal Methods Compared

How the main payment methods stack up for SA casino withdrawals. Speed estimates apply to verified accounts during business hours.

Method Speed Min Max Fees Availability
EFT (Bank Transfer) 1 to 3 business days R50 R100,000+ None (casino side) All major operators
Ozow Deposit only at most sites R10 R50,000 None Betway, Easybet, Gbets
Capitec Pay Same day (often instant) R20 R25,000 None Supersportbet, betXchange
FNB eWallet Same day to 24 hours R20 R5,000 per day R8.50 per send (FNB) Supabets, Gbets
OTT Voucher Deposit only R5 R1,000 None Widely available for deposits
Visa / Mastercard 3 to 5 business days R50 R50,000 Possible bank fee Most operators
Skrill / NETELLER 1 to 2 business days R50 R50,000 Possible e-wallet fee Sportingbet, Jabula Bets

Note: OTT Voucher is a deposit-only method at SA casinos. Withdrawals must go back to a bank account or approved electronic method.

How to Speed Up Your Casino Withdrawal

Complete FICA Verification First

FICA (Financial Intelligence Centre Act) verification is the single biggest factor in withdrawal speed. SA operators are legally required to verify your identity before paying out above certain thresholds. Submit your ID document and proof of address as soon as you register, not when you first try to withdraw. Operators who already have your documents on file process withdrawals days faster than those waiting for your first submission.

Documents accepted at most operators: South African ID book or smart card, valid South African passport, or a foreign national ID with a valid SA visa. Proof of address must be dated within 3 months, such as a bank statement, utility bill, or municipal rates notice.

Choose the Right Withdrawal Method

EFT is available everywhere but isn't always the fastest option. If your bank is Capitec, Capitec Pay integration (available at Supersportbet and betXchange) processes withdrawals same-day for verified accounts. FNB eWallet is another fast option for FNB customers. Card withdrawals (Visa/Mastercard) are consistently the slowest, often taking 3 to 5 business days.

Meet All Wagering Requirements Before Withdrawing

If you accepted a welcome bonus, bonus funds have wagering requirements attached. A casino will hold your withdrawal request until those requirements are met. Check your bonus balance and wagering progress in the account section before submitting a withdrawal request. Bonus funds that haven't been wagered are typically forfeited, not withdrawn.

Request Withdrawals on Weekday Mornings

Most SA operators process withdrawal batches during business hours on weekdays. A request submitted Monday morning will typically process faster than one submitted Friday afternoon or over the weekend. Weekend and public holiday requests often sit in the queue until the next business day's processing run.

Same-Day Withdrawal Casinos

A handful of SA-licensed operators consistently process withdrawals within the same business day for verified accounts. "Same-day" means the operator initiates the transfer on the day of your request. Your bank may still take hours to credit the funds.

Casino Same-Day Method Condition
Betway EFT (weekdays) FICA verified, submitted before noon
Hollywoodbets Cash at branch Branch visit required, ID needed
Supersportbet Capitec Pay Capitec account required
betXchange Capitec Pay Capitec account required
Supabets FNB eWallet FNB account required
Easybet EFT (weekdays) FICA verified, no pending bonus

Frequently Asked Questions

Which SA casino pays out the fastest?

Betway and Sportingbet consistently process withdrawals within 24 hours when using EFT. For Capitec users, Supersportbet and betXchange offer same-day Capitec Pay withdrawals. Hollywoodbets offers cash at branches which is immediate. The key is completing FICA verification before requesting a withdrawal.

How long do casino withdrawals take in South Africa?

EFT withdrawals typically take 1 to 3 business days. Ozow and Capitec Pay can process same-day for verified players. OTT Voucher is a deposit-only method. The longest delays usually come from pending FICA documents rather than the payment method.

What is the minimum withdrawal amount at SA casinos?

Most licensed SA casinos set the minimum at R50 to R100 for EFT. Some operators like Supabets allow from R20. Maximum daily limits range from R5,000 at smaller operators to R100,000 at established brands like Betway.

Why is my casino withdrawal taking so long?

The most common cause is incomplete FICA verification. SA operators must verify your identity before processing large withdrawals. Pending bonus wagering requirements can also hold withdrawals. Contact the casino's live chat with your withdrawal reference number if the delay exceeds 3 business days.

What documents do I need for FICA verification?

A valid South African ID (green book or smart card) plus proof of address dated within 3 months. A bank statement, utility bill, or municipal account works. Some operators also request a selfie with your ID for extra verification.

Does Ozow withdraw instantly from SA casinos?

Ozow is primarily a deposit method at most SA casinos. For fast withdrawals, Capitec Pay and FNB eWallet are the best near-instant options. EFT to your bank account is the standard withdrawal route and usually takes 1 to 2 business days.

Are there withdrawal fees at SA casinos?

Most licensed SA operators don't charge withdrawal fees on the casino side. Your bank may apply standard EFT receiving fees depending on your account type. Check the operator's banking page before withdrawing for any stated processing fees on large amounts.

Can I withdraw casino winnings to a different bank account?

No. SA gambling regulations require withdrawals to go back to the same bank account or payment method used for the deposit. This is an anti-money-laundering requirement. If you deposited via Ozow linked to your Capitec account, the withdrawal must return to that account.
